The classes have been nice, but every other aspect of this school delivers frustrating experiences. The financial aid department seems very under qualified. Their lack of experience and lack of helpfulness resulted in my financial aid being late.

Every attempt I have made to make an appointment with a counselor has been futile. I have tried over the course of months and there have never been any dates available. I tried using the online counseling service and have never received a response. I'm in my second semester and I don't even know if I'm taking the right classes because I've never spoken with a counselor.

I also almost spent 260.00 on a book that the bookstore had labeled as a required text for one of my classes. It would have been a final sale. Luckily, I went to class before purchasing it and learned that they are no longer using that book. Even though the bookstore had it clearly labeled under that class/section number.

Every aspect of this school, besides the actual classes are just unorganized and unsympathetic. I guess you shouldn't expect much from a community college, but I'd expect a little more of any place I'm giving money.
